The NICG Governance Conference, held on 22 October 2025, brought together some of Namibia’s most respected voices in leadership and governance under the theme “Governance in a Transformative Era.” The gathering created a space for honest reflection on how institutions can adapt to change while keeping integrity and accountability at the heart of leadership.
The day unfolded through dynamic conversations and thought-provoking exchanges. From discussions on policy-driven governance and stewardship in leadership to reflections on Namibia’s emerging energy markets and the future of governance itself, each session invited participants to think differently about what it means to lead in times of transition.
Among those who shared their insights were Salomo Hei, Mutindi Jacobs, David Nuyoma, Hilda Basson-Namundjebo, Christie Keulder, Ekkehard Friedrich, Fabian Shaanika, Hon. Amb. Dr Kaire Mbuende, Amb. Lineekela Mboti, Escher Luanda, Rev. Dr Betty Schroder, Vetumbuavi Mungunda, and Graham Hopwood. The conversations were guided by facilitators Morna Ikosa, Marvin Amuenje, and Denver Kisting, whose thoughtful moderation kept the dialogue engaging and relevant.
